Aim: The student shall by analyzing the original literature achieve detailed knowledge of the parameters of the indoor climate and their effect on man's comfort, health and work. The student will be able to calculate, analyze and evaluate climate in practice.
|
Contents: Thermal indoor climate, conditions for comfort, instationary conditions, draught, modelling and measuring of perceived air quality. Identification of pollution sources and ventilation rates. The effect on human beings of ventilation efficiency and air flow patterns in rooms. Bioeffluents, tobacco smoke, combustion products, outgassing from building materials, air humidity, microorganisms, randon, ions and electrical fields. Measuring methods and instruments. Strategy for performing indoor climate investigations in practice
